Describe the development of renal corpuscle
-Primitive renal tubule (which is derived from ureteric bud) is a blind ended tube which envelops growing glomerulus producing renal corpuscle
2
What is the vascular pole of the renal corpuscle?
-Afferent and efferent arterioles which form the glomerulus
3
What is the urinary pole of the renal corpuscle?
-Bowmans capsule
4
What are the two layers of the bowmans capsule and what lies between them?
-Parietal and visceral
-Bowmans space
5
What forms the filtration barrier of the renal corpuscle?
-Visceral layer of bowmans capsule (podocytes with foot processes)
-Fenestrated Capillary endothelium
6
How are podocytes formed?
-Visceral layer of bowmans capsule wraps around capillary endothelium
7
What is the function of the podocytes?
-To form filtration slits which overlap the fenestrated capillary

What epithelia lines PCT?
-Simple cuboidal with brush border
9
what is the longest most convoluted section of the nephron?
-PCT
10
What are the 4 parts of the loop of henle?
-Pars Recta
-thin descending limb
-thin ascending limb
-thick ascending limb
11
What epithelia lines thin limbs in loop of henle?
-Simple squamous
12
What epithelia lines thick ascending limb in loop of henle?
-Simple cuboidal
13
Where in the kidney is the DCT?
-Cortex
14
What is special about the DCT epithelia?
-Contain numerous mitochondria for active transport
15
What makes up the juxtaglomerulus apparatus?
-The macula densa of DCT
-Juxtaglomerular cells of afferent arteriole of parent glomerulus
-Extraglomerular mesangial cells (lacis cells)
16
What is the macula densa?
-An area of dense cells which touch the parent afferent arteriole
17
What is the histiological difference between CD and DCT tubules?
-CD lumen larger and more irregular
18
What is the renal pyramid?
-organisation and merging of collecting ducts to form progressively larger ducts which empty into renal papilla
19
Describe the muscular histology of the ureter
-A muscular tube which has two layers of smooth muscle with a third layer appearing in lower third
20
What epithelium lines the ureter?
-Transitional
